ALTOONA -- Penn State wide receiver Saeed Blacknall and linebacker Manny Bowen stayed in California with their teammates for last year's Rose Bowl, but they didn't participate.
While both players were suspended from the game for a violation of team rules, they still remained on the trip. On Thursday, during the Penn State Coaches Caravan's stop in Altoona, head coach James Franklin talked about the decision to let Blacknall and Bowen travel with the team and his overall philosophy on disciplining players.
"I think that's one of the things coaches struggle with, I think businesses struggle with, universities struggle with, is that when they make decisions, people on the outside judge those decisions," Franklin said, "but they have very little of the information, in my opinion, to make that judgement with.
